Please Join Us for our 22nd Annual
Conservation Celebration!


September 12, 2026, from 11am - 3pm
at Curwensville Lake, 1256 Lake Drive, Curwensville, PA 16833
** ALL ACTIVITIES ARE FREE! ***

Come have fun in the great outdoors and learn how you can protect our valuable natural resources!  Fun for all ages!​
Admission to the Park will be waived if you bring one non-perishable food item per person to donate for our local food banks.

Picture
Image from www.ryanthebugman.com
The "Bug Man"
Entomologist Ryan Bridge believes that hands-on and close-up are the best ways to learn about insects. Come out to learn about the importance of insects and more fun facts about the insects around us. 
Picture
Centre Wildlife Care
Learn more about our native Pennsylvania wildlife and the other creatures they care for. Learn about ways to help protect these important species. 
And So Many More Activities!
  • Get up close and personal with snakes, with Stacey the Snake Lady.
  • Build a birdhouse to take home. 
  • See how land and water interact at our hands-on stream table.
  • ​Enjoy our Conservation Games to win small prizes.
  • Take part in a SMART Angler fishing activity.
  • Hold the pelts and prints of our local wildlife.
  • ​And so much more!
